Re: ram expansion
I had a GS-RAM Plus which I finally got rid of because it had some sort of
conflict with my RAMFast SCSI card, or perhaps my ZipGS although I believe
it was the former. The Serius doesn't seem to have the same problem.
Oh yes, the problem was that memory would sometimes get a bit garbled. This
was most clearly demonstrated by running Apple.RX.GS, Glen Bredon's virus
checker. It would occasionally report a file as being changed but if run
immediately again it would report a different file as bad, or none at all.
BTW Bredon himself suggested using this program for sorting out memory
problems so I'm not suggesting anything original here.
